BET Cruises Into High Gear With an All-New Reality Series, 'THE FAMILY CREWS', Premiering on Sunday, February 21 at 9:00 p.m. *

TV's Favorite Family Man Terry Crews Proves Life is Never Dull When He Turns Cameras On His Own Family in This New Original Series

PASADENA, Calif., Jan. 14 -- Everyone may hate Chris, but everyone loves America's favorite TV father and funny man, Terry Crews. And now viewers have a chance to know and love his own family of seven on the new original series THE FAMILY CREWS, premiering Sunday, February 21 at 9:00 p.m.*

A former professional football player turned successful Hollywood actor, Terry is anything but your typical superstar courtesy of his eclectic and ever-changing brood ranging in ages from 22 to 3 years old and his wife of 20 years, Rebecca -- who keeps him grounded on a daily basis. On the outside, the Crews' are the picture of class and calm. But behind closed doors, there are antics, laughter and sometimes mayhem that seem to drive Daddy Crews crazy until he accepts that fact that he's living on "Crews Control." Viewers will watch the Crews family grow, love, laugh and pray their way through a new chapter in their journey as Terry begins the process of transitioning from Everybody Hate Chris to a bon-a-fide action star and Rebecca, who put her dreams on hold to support Terry and raise their family, begins to more aggressively pursue those dreams. From Terry and his wife Rebecca to their five children and family dog Coffee, there is never a dull moment under the Crews' roof.

MEET THE CREWS:

TERRY CREWS

Terry Crews�is "Ready for This." Huge opportunities continue to manifest for Terry after years of working hard in Hollywood. He attributes this to the faith and prayers of himself, and his beautiful wife, Rebecca.

REBECCA CREWS

Rebecca Crews�"It's Her Time to Shine." She's the staunch backbone of the family, raising five children, as well as supporting her husband's career and its successes for 20 years. She realizes that now is the best time to focus on pursuing her own singing, acting, producing and writing.

NAOMI BURTON

Naomi Burton�"On My Own." The 22 year-old rebellious beauty embraces her new found adulthood and desires to be her own woman, striving to carve a name for herself, separate and apart from her family.

AZRIEL CREWS

Azriel Crews�"The Actrisse." Eighteen year-old Azriel is eager to follow in her dad's footsteps and pursue acting. She believes that it's her time to break out and shine as she works diligently towards coming into her own as a young, talented actress.

TERRA CREWS

Terra Crews�"Daddy's Girl." A self-proclaimed "Daddy's Little Girl," 10 year-old Terra finds her way in among four siblings while shaping her individuality apart from Daddy.

WYNFREY CREWS

Wynfrey Crews�"Oprah's Namesake and Reincarnate." Six year-old Wynfrey makes sure that she's always the center of the family's attention and makes it abundantly clear that she can easily adjust to her family's rise in popularity.

ISAIAH CREWS

Isaiah Crews�"The Prince of the Family." Three year-old Isaiah is the center of everyone's heart, and is the "Little Prince" of his family. His strong and energetic personality will undoubtedly capture viewers' hearts.

THE FAMILY CREWS is executive produced by Terry and Rebecca Crews, Robi Reed and Strange Fruit Media's D'Angela Proctor Steed and Nia T. Hill, the executive producing team behind television's #1 gospel competition show, SUNDAY BEST and ALMOST MARRIED, a new reality series that follows two of SUNDAY BEST 2's top finalists as they answer the question whether all is fair in love and fame.
